Joyful Noise debuts this week at #1 on Billboard’s Soundtrack Chart, #1 on the Billboard Gospel chart, #2 on Billboard’s Christian chart, #2 on the Billboard Independent Current Albums chart, and landed a Top 20 debut on Billboard’s Top Current Albums chart.
The soundtrack features performances by Dolly Parton; Queen Latifah; Keke Palmer; Karen Peck; and Kirk Franklin. Five-time Grammy®, six-time Dove, two-time Stellar Award winner Mervyn Warren produced and arranged the Joyful Noise soundtrack.
Dolly wrote three new songs for the collection, “From Here to the Moon and Back,” “Not Enough,” a duet with co-star Queen Latifah, and “He’s Everything,” which includes the film’s stars performing renditions of memorable songs originally recorded by a wide range of artists: Chris Brown, Michael Jackson, Paul McCartney, Sly & the Family Stone, Usher, and Stevie Wonder.
The collection also includes tracks by some of the finest acts in gospel and R&B. Grammy winner Kirk Franklin wrote and takes the vocal reins on his jubilant new song “In Love,” and award-winning gospel vocalist Karen Peck creates harmonic gold on “Mighty High.”
